titleOfInvention |
Method of detecting pork in processed food and detection kit therefor |
abstract |
[Object] To provide preparation of an ingredient derived from a specimen optimal for detecting by immunoassay pork in heated food with high performance and high sensitivity without causing non-specific reaction, a convenient and high-accuracy detection method using a polyclonal antibody obtained by using the ingredient, and a detection kit therefor. n [Solution] When a target to be detected in a sample, pork-derived protein in heat-processed food, is detected by immunochromatography, a polyclonal antibody specifically recognizing a protein of approximately 23 kD (molecular weight: 23000) contained in heat-treated pork is used as at least one or both detection antibodies. |
